CELL & GENE MEETING ON THE MESA 7th Annual PARTNERING FORUM October 4-5, 2017 Estancia La Jolla Hotel | La Jolla, CA 6th Annual PUBLIC FORUM October 5, 2017 Sanford Consortium for Regenerative Medicine | La Jolla, CA 12th Annual SCIENTIFIC SYMPOSIUM October 6, 2017 Salk Institute for Biological Studies | La Jolla, CA MORE INFO & REGISTRATION www.meetingonthemesa.com ABOUT THE OVERALL MEETING The Cell & Gene Meeting on the Mesa is a three-day conference bringing together senior executives and top decision-makers in the industry with the scientific community to advance cutting-edge research into cures. The meeting features a nationally recognized Scientific Symposium, attended by leading researchers and clinical experts from around the globe, in conjunction with the industry’s premier annual Partnering Forum, the first event of its kind dedicated solely to facilitating connections in this sector. Combined, these meetings attract over 850 attendees, fostering key partnerships through more than 1100 one-on-one meetings while highlighting the significant clinical and commercial progress in the field. ABOUT THE SCIENTIFIC SYMPOSIUM The Scientific Symposium at the Cell & Gene Meeting on the Mesa attracts leading scientists, clinicians, life science business executives, patient advocates and government officials, with the aim of examining the imminent scientific and ethical challenges facing cell and gene therapy research today. The format is designed around panel discussions exploring topics ranging from basic science to revolutionary techniques and includes keynote presentations from world renowned researchers. ABOUT THE PARTNERING FORUM The annual Partnering Forum at the Cell & Gene Meeting on the Mesa is the largest partnering meeting organized specifically for the advanced therapies industry. The Alliance for Regenerative Medicine (ARM)’s extensive network of companies, investors, patient advocates, and government agencies provides attendees with the opportunity to establish key relationships aimed at accelerating business development in the field. Furthermore, ARM created the event to specifically facilitate translational research, PI engagement in the business community, and enable business, academic research and investor participants to connect for one-on-one meetings and strategic dealmaking.
